Be part of your child’s education. Do not let your child just go to school and assume the learning will happen there. For instance, if my child is learning in school about butterfly metamorphosis, as a parent I will go outside and look for mealworm larva when I’m upstate with my children to help reinforce that learning. I think it’s so important that you’re just as invested in the learning as they are.
